Electronics Technology is the backbone of modern innovations, enabling the development of smart devices, communication systems, embedded systems, and industrial automation. It covers a wide range of fields, from circuit design to IoT and power electronics.
In this category, explore expert insights on:
Basic Electronics – Resistors, capacitors, diodes, transistors, and ICs.
Analog & Digital Electronics – Signal processing, ADC/DAC, and logic circuits.
Microcontrollers & Embedded Systems – Arduino, ESP32, Raspberry Pi, and ARM-based systems.
Power Electronics – SMPS, inverters, converters, and motor drivers.
IoT & Wireless Communication – Sensor integration, Bluetooth, Wi-Fi, Zigbee, and LoRa.
PCB Design & Circuit Simulation – EDA tools, schematic design, and PCB manufacturing.
Automation & Robotics – Motor control, PLCs, and AI-driven electronics.
